ping is more stable.
previously speed test, 50% chance i get 40-60ms, 50% chances about 60-200ms.
now 90% 40-50ms, 10% 50-200ms (3G isnt as stable as FO connection, deal with it)

for the speed, dont hope too much.
previously 50% chances i get bet 5-8mbps, 30% will get either 3-5mbps or 8-12mbps, sometime gone crazy 20% chances will get about 1-3mbps or 12-18mbps.
now 60% chances i get 6-10mbps, 30% about 3-6mbps or 10-12mbps, 10% below 3mbps or above 12mbps.


i hardly see huge improve only about 10-20%, the speed affected by many issue, signal strength only 1 of its. specially when my signal strength already 60% without antenna, with antenna it will improve to 80% but the speed wont be improve that much.

however if without antenna the signal strength is below 40%, i believe the antenna will bring significant results.
